| Incorporating physiological knowledge into correlative species distribution models minimizes bias introduced by the choice of calibration area Zhang, Z.; Zhou, J.; García Molinos, J.; Mammola, S.; Bede-Fazekas, Á.; Feng, X.; Kitazawa, D.; Assis, J.; Qiu, T.; Lin, Q. (2024). Incorporating physiological knowledge into correlative species distribution models minimizes bias introduced by the choice of calibration area. Marine Life Science & Technology 6(2): 349-362. https://dx.doi.org/10.1007/s42995-024-00226-0
In: Marine Life Science & Technology. Springer Nature: London. ISSN 2096-6490; e-ISSN 2662-1746, meer
